What is valet parking in San Francisco?
San Francisco valet parking is a staffed parking service where uniformed attendants park and retrieve guest vehicles at a venue. In San Francisco, valet is most common at Michelin-starred restaurants, luxury hotels, and downtown corporate offices. All About Parking handles the staffing, traffic flow, and on-site equipment so the host can focus on the event.
